Half of Lithuanians are not physically active

  • 2018-08-30
  • BNS/TBT Staff
Half of people in Lithuania are not physically active, a 2017 Eurobarometer survey has revealed. 51 percent of respondents in Lithuania said they never exercise, compared to 56 percent in Latvia and 48 percent in Estonia. According to the Department of Physical Education and Spots, the number of physically inactive people in Lithuania has been growing in recent years as it stood at 44 percent in 2010 and 46 percent in 2014. Across the EU, Bulgarians are the most physically inactive (68 percent don’t exercise) and Finnish people are the most active...
